Output e6c77d68c96f1415e5ac7e5e40fefb3fdb2bde6d133ce76dac3e7c7bbc26da51:3

value
34275
script pubkey
OP_0 OP_PUSHBYTES_20 72c2babff2ee196064c466e66bef3644402db91e
address
bc1qwtpt40ljacvkqexyvmnxhmekg3qzmwg79jcqr2
transaction
e6c77d68c96f1415e5ac7e5e40fefb3fdb2bde6d133ce76dac3e7c7bbc26da51
spent
true